Why the Same V2403 Part Number Ships in Multiple Variants

The V2403 Cylinder Head for Kubota KX121-3 cross reference fitment depends on serial range, not just model name.

Over the years in the Yangtze Delta equipment corridor, I have pulled cylinder heads off V2403 engines where the oil gallery port sat a few millimetres off from what the manual showed. The casting number matched, but the production revision did not. A batch ordered against a generic cross-reference table arrived and sat on the bench while the machine stayed down [NEED_CITE: engine serial breakpoint tracking in aftermarket parts distribution]. Kubota shifted valve seat geometry and coolant passage routing across V2403 production runs, meaning the same base identifier can point to heads with different port layouts.

Serial Range and Variant Boundaries Across Kubota Models

The V2403 engine family spans Kubota excavators from the KX121-2 through the KX161-3ST, plus the U45S compact unit. Each model generation introduced block revisions that changed head bolt spacing or rocker arm pedestal height. A head that bolts on to a 2005-era KX121-3 may not seat correctly on a 2010 KX121-3ST without checking the serial breakpoint. Port Position and Bolt Pattern Verification

Before any head leaves our Guangzhou warehouse, the port positions are measured against the applicable Kubota service data for that serial segment. Coolant outlet flange orientation, exhaust port spacing, and injector bore angles are checked against the old unit when a photograph or core sample is available [NEED_CITE: cylinder head dimensional inspection methods for diesel engines]. The head bolt hole pattern is verified for thread engagement depth, because some V2403 block revisions changed from M10 to M12 bolts mid-production. This interface check is the difference between a head that drops on and one that requires drilling or tapping on site.

Interpreting the Cross-Reference Chain

The identifier 1G855-03042B sits within a web of Kubota reference numbers including 1G916-03040B, 1G780-03043B, 1G896-03040B, 1G851-03042B, 1J854-03040B and 1J860-03040B (all for cross-reference identification). Not every number in this chain is a direct swap. Some supersede earlier castings that had different combustion chamber volumes or valve guide diameters. Fitment Check Before Installation

  • Compare head bolt hole pattern and thread size against your block before lifting the head into position
  • Verify coolant and oil port alignment with the block gasket surface using a straight edge
  • Confirm valve clearance specification matches your V2403 service manual revision
  • Check rocker arm pedestal height against the old head if performing a direct swap
  • Torque head bolts in the Kubota-specified sequence and verify after a heat cycle
